Gregori Saavedra was born in Viladecans (Barcelona, SPAIN) in 1968. Graduated in Information Sciences by the University of Barcelona (SPAIN) in 1992. His professional career in advertising started at BDDP·Target as junior copywriter. Afterwards, he worked in four more agencies as creative director: Pongiluppi & Guimaraes, Valverde/De Miquel, J.Walter Thompson and Lorente Euro RSCG.
In 2003, after more than ten years in advertising, he decided to be freelance and explore some other disciplines like direction, illustration, design,... As director he was selected by MTV for the MTV Load Project (2005), selected director by RESFEST 2005 (By Design section), selected as one of the 10 Best New Directors by WEBCUTS BERLIN (2005) and also prized as Best Director by BD4D (By Designers For Designers) in 2006. His video work has been exhibited and showcased in several festivals like Prixars (France, 2005), LOOP (Spain, 2005), Square Eyes Festival (The Netherlands, 2006), DiBa (Spain, 2009) and it is part of the permanent collection at the Austin Digital Art Museum (USA).
As illustrator, Gregori Saavedra´s artwork has been published by Die Gestalten Verlag, IdN, PigMag, DPI Taiwan, Dazed and Confused, Time, Rojo, NEO2, Bis Publishers, Ling, Gustavo Gili, Actar, Die Ziet, Collins Design, New Graphic China, The Gutenberg’s Quarterly,... In 2007, the curators of ILLUSTRATIVE, the most important illustration international forum, selected him as one of the most relevant illustrators worldwide. Later on, in 2009, UNESCO granted his CODE prize to Gregori Saavedra as one of the 20 BEST ILLUSTRATORS OF THE YEAR.
Since 2010 he is stablished in London (UK).
